Page MenuHomePhabricator

Bundle Thanks extension with MediaWiki
Closed, ResolvedPublic

Description

  • Passed security review or already Wikimedia deployed
  • Voting CI structure tests
  • Runs MediaWiki-CodeSniffer
  • Runs phan
  • Supports MySQL, SQLite, and Postgres (no schema changes)
  • GPL v2 or later compatible license
  • Extension's default configuration provides optimal experience
  • Tested with web installer
  • T191738: Bundle Echo extension with MediaWiki

Related Objects

Event Timeline

Legoktm subscribed.

AFAICT Thanks is useless without Echo, but there's no hard dependency set in extension.json?

Legoktm updated the task description. (Show Details)

AFAICT Thanks is useless without Echo, but there's no hard dependency set in extension.json?

Hard dependency set in https://gerrit.wikimedia.org/r/#/c/425483/

CCicalese_WMF renamed this task from Bundle Thanks extension with MW 1.32 to Bundle Thanks extension with MediaWiki.Nov 10 2018, 6:49 PM

Hey there. This task is proposed as a blocker to MediaWiki 1.37, which will be cut in less than three weeks' time. Please consider whether this will make that deadline, and if not, move it to block the MediaWiki 1.38 release (MW-1.38-release) or remove as a blocker entirely.

jforrester opened https://gitlab.wikimedia.org/repos/releng/release/-/merge_requests/10

Add Echo, LoginNotfiy, and Thanks to the default MediaWiki bundle

jforrester merged https://gitlab.wikimedia.org/repos/releng/release/-/merge_requests/10

Add Echo, LoginNotfiy, and Thanks to the default MediaWiki bundle